The Rise of LED Technology in Tanning Beds

LED technology has revolutionized various sectors, and tanning beds are no exception. Traditionally, tanning beds utilized fluorescent or incandescent bulbs, which not only consumed more energy but also had a shorter lifespan. The shift to LED technology offers numerous advantages, making it a preferred choice for both consumers and contractors.

Energy Efficiency

One of the most significant benefits of LED tanning beds is their energy efficiency. LEDs consume significantly less power compared to traditional bulbs, which translates to lower electricity bills for users. For lighting contractors, this means the potential for offering clients a more sustainable and cost-effective solution. The reduced energy consumption not only benefits the wallet but also contributes to a smaller carbon footprint, making LED tanning beds an environmentally friendly option. As consumers become more eco-conscious, the demand for energy-efficient solutions continues to rise, further solidifying the role of LEDs in the tanning industry.

Longevity and Maintenance

LEDs typically have a lifespan of up to 50,000 hours, far exceeding that of traditional tanning bed bulbs. This longevity reduces the frequency of replacements, resulting in lower maintenance costs. For contractors, this aspect can be a strong selling point when discussing the long-term benefits with clients. Additionally, the durability of LEDs means they are less prone to breakage, which can be a significant concern in high-traffic tanning salons. This reliability not only enhances customer satisfaction but also ensures that the tanning beds remain operational for longer periods, maximizing revenue potential for salon owners.

Designing a DIY LED Tanning Bed

Creating a DIY LED tanning bed requires careful planning and execution. Lighting contractors must consider several factors, including the design layout, LED specifications, and safety measures. By following a structured approach, contractors can ensure a successful installation.

Choosing the Right LEDs

The choice of LEDs is crucial in the design of a tanning bed. Contractors should select high-quality LEDs that emit the appropriate wavelengths for effective tanning. Typically, a combination of UVA and UVB LEDs is recommended to achieve optimal results. Additionally, considering the wattage and lumens output is essential to ensure adequate coverage and intensity. It is also beneficial to research the latest advancements in LED technology, as newer models may offer improved energy efficiency and longer lifespans, which can ultimately reduce operational costs over time.

Design Layout and Structure

The physical design of the tanning bed should facilitate even light distribution. Contractors can opt for a flat or curved design, depending on the desired aesthetics and functionality. It’s important to ensure that the LEDs are spaced appropriately to avoid hot spots or uneven tanning. A well-thought-out layout will enhance the overall user experience. Furthermore, incorporating adjustable features, such as tilting panels or movable sections, can provide users with customizable angles for optimal tanning exposure, catering to individual preferences and body types.

Safety Considerations

Safety is paramount when designing a DIY tanning bed. Contractors must incorporate features such as protective covers for the LEDs to prevent direct eye exposure. Additionally, proper ventilation must be ensured to prevent overheating. Adhering to safety standards not only protects users but also enhances the credibility of the contractor. It is also advisable to include a timer mechanism that automatically shuts off the tanning bed after a set duration, reducing the risk of overexposure. Moreover, providing clear instructions and safety guidelines for users will help foster a responsible tanning environment, ensuring that everyone can enjoy the benefits of their DIY creation without compromising their health.
